Waqar is Head of Corporate Affairs & Sustainability at Nestlé Pakistan & Afghanistan. He is responsible for leading institutional networking and multi-stakeholders engagement for public policy and business advocacy with the government, multilaterals, media and non-profits by building alliances for winning partnerships. He is also leading sustainability (Creating Shared Value) agenda to deliver UNSDGs by engaging communities and partners in the value chain.

Prior joining Nestlé, he worked as a Private Sector Specialist at the World Bank and was a Summer Scholar at the International Monetary Fund (IMF). Waqar has also worked as CEO-TheNetwork for Consumer Protection, Executive Director-SAARC Chamber of Commerce and Industry, an apex business organization of SAARC and was on consulting assignments with International Chamber of Commerce, Euro Chambers and Commonwealth Business Council.

He has a proven leadership and years of professional experience in areas of strategic management & crisis communication, public policy advocacy, action-oriented research and managing public affairs with focus on multi-stakeholders’ engagement, building alliance and partnerships for reputational management. Waqar is a Columbia University, New York graduate in MPA–Economic Policy Management (2010), and also held prestigious Chevening Fellowship (2008) in Responsible Business, University of Nottingham, UK.
